Reel Big Fish are reporting that Zomba has acquired Mojo "as part of a push to diversify its artist roster and beef up its catalog offerings." They posted a statement by Jive Records president Barry Weiss saying, "Mojo has developed an array of credible, commercially successful artists who have succeeded by building fans through the traditional, painstaking, foolproof method of relentless touring... This has led to very strong career foundations that we hope to build upon.''
